Zhang Xue’s motorcycle victory at the Portugal WSBK race is not only a historic breakthrough for Chinese motorcycle manufacturing but also a key stepping stone for brand upgrading of Dongpeng Special Drink. This cross-industry collaboration, initiated spontaneously by netizens—ranging from Zhang Xue’s public call for sponsors to tens of thousands of netizens flooding Dongpeng’s official account to call for support—was quickly responded to and announced by the brand, completing the transformation from grassroots voice to commercial success in just a few months.

Compared to international brands investing tens of millions in events, Dongpeng’s “pocket change” approach to top-tier competitions has yielded unexpectedly high returns. The brand logo appeared on the champion’s visuals across more than 150 countries, gaining over 1 billion exposures, with an exposure value exceeding 50 million yuan. The return on investment is a benchmark in the industry. More importantly, Dongpeng successfully shed its “rustic” label, establishing a passionate image of “supporting Chinese manufacturing,” and building recognition as a “national product light” among young consumers. Brand search volume surged by 320%, and offline terminal sales also increased simultaneously.

This is not accidental success but the result of Dongpeng’s long-term deep cultivation of trendy youth marketing. From sponsoring KPL esports leagues and F4 Formula racing to becoming designated functional drinks for the World Cup and Asian Games, the brand has already built a comprehensive scene marketing matrix covering esports, sports, and fashion. The Zhang Xue motorcycle collaboration, with its “user co-creation and small, efficient investments” innovative model, provides a textbook case for FMCG marketing, achieving dual harvests of brand voice and market conversion.

Behind eye-catching marketing is Dongpeng Beverage’s solid performance foundation. In 2025, the company achieved revenue of 20.88B yuan, up 31.8%; net profit of 4.42B yuan, up 32.72%, with scale and profitability improving in tandem. Although the growth rate slowed compared to 2024, maintaining over 30% growth on a 20 billion yuan base remains industry-leading, demonstrating strong growth resilience.

As a core fundamental, Dongpeng Special Drink has entered the 15 billion yuan super product camp, with 2025 revenue of 15.6B yuan, accounting for 75% of total revenue. Despite the high base, the energy drink segment’s 17.25% growth, though slower than the previous 25%+, continues to strengthen its market position: sales market share rose from 47.9% to 51.6%, revenue market share from 34.9% to 38.3%, ranking first in sales volume for five consecutive years and officially topping China’s energy drink market. The company states that returning to double-digit growth for such a large product volume is healthy, and scale effects are gradually releasing, ensuring the core fundamentals remain absolutely solid.

More noteworthy is the explosive growth of the second growth curve. The electrolyte drink “Hydrate” launched just three years ago, with 2025 revenue reaching 3.27B yuan, a surge of 118.99% year-on-year. Its revenue share jumped from 9.45% to 15.7%, successfully entering the 3-billion-yuan product category. With its precise positioning of “rapid electrolyte replenishment” and full-channel coverage, Hydrate has become a leader in the electrolyte beverage market, forming a “energy + electrolyte” dual-core driving pattern. Meanwhile, categories like tea drinks, coffee, and plant-based proteins generated 3B yuan in revenue, up 94.08%, forming a preliminary product matrix with multiple support points.

Faced with industry shifts from price wars to quality, supply chain, and operational efficiency, Dongpeng Beverage is building a multi-dimensional strategic moat to sustain growth. On the channel front, the company has over 4.5 million terminal outlets and more than 3,400 distributors, creating a deep nationwide network. The current channel focus is shifting from expansion to quality improvement and efficiency, deepening traditional channels to increase per-store output, while accelerating breakthroughs in instant retail, catering, vending machines, and other emerging channels for full coverage. Strong channel control is the core guarantee for rapid new product volume and continuous market share growth.

In product R&D, the company adheres to the “1+6” multi-category strategy, consolidating core advantages while accelerating new product incubation. In 2025, R&D expenses reached 1.99B yuan, up 5.85%, with ongoing investment in innovation. Dongpeng Special Drink launched sugar-free and fortified taurine variants to meet health trends; Hydrate improved its full-specification matrix from portable to family sizes, covering sports, daily, outdoor scenarios. Precise product innovation helps the company stay ahead in a market increasingly rational and focused on high quality and cost performance.

International expansion has officially begun, with the company initiating localized operations in Southeast Asia, steadily advancing its globalization. As a domestic beverage leader listed in both A-shares and H-shares, Dongpeng leverages product strength and supply chain advantages to unlock new long-term growth space. Meanwhile, the company continues to optimize expense control, with a period expense ratio of only 18.91% in 2025, and profitability steadily improving under scale effects, providing abundant cash flow for long-term development.

Of course, Dongpeng’s rapid growth also faces stage-specific challenges. The energy drink market’s penetration rate is approaching a ceiling, making high growth in major products more difficult; competition in the electrolyte segment intensifies as giants like Nongfu Spring and Mengniu enter, with rising price and channel competition. Additionally, multi-category incubation still requires time, and overseas markets are in early stages, unlikely to contribute significant short-term performance.
